What are Jujubes?

Jujubes (Zizyphus Jujuba), also known as red dates, are the fruit a small deciduous shrub widely distributed throughout Southern Asia. They have long been treasured in tradition Chinese medicine for the alleviation of insomnia, stress, anxiety and as a general health tonic.

What are some of the benefits of Jujube dates?

Jujubes are low in calories, high in fibre and are known to be a valuable source of vital nutrients. In addition, recent studies have shown them to be rich in biologically active phytochemicals such as polyphenols flavonoids and alkaloids which may be beneficial in health and disease (see below).

Other important biologically active compounds found in Jujubes include:

  • Vitamins: Jujube have 20 times more vitamin C than citrus fruits and are rich in vitamin B.
  • Minerals: Calcium, Magnesium and Potassium.

Potential benefits of Jujube:

  1. An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ties which help reverse free-radical induced damage in many organs including the liver.
  2. Immunomodulatory and immune-boosting effects important in combating chronic disease and cancer prevention.
  3. Antimicrobial and antifungal properties independent of its action on the immune system.
  4. Improved digestion due to its high fibre content and prevention of stomach and intestinal ulcers.
  5. Improved cognitive function.

Jujube dates are also great at providing a quick energy boost and have long been used to improve the quality of sleep and reduce stress and anxiety.

Are Jujube dates safe for dogs?

In moderation, they certainly are and can be a nice treat for them to enjoy!  If your dog is on any medication, check with your vet first as there may be potential interactions.

Are there any side effects?

Fortunately, there are no major side effects of Jujube dates. They do however contain sugar and although the amount is not high, canine biology is not well adapted to have a lot of sugar and excess consumption may lead to problems.
